When it comes to micro air pumps, B-side customers (i.e. enterprise or organizational customers) are usually concerned with a number of key issues to ensure that the selected product can meet their production or operational needs and deliver economic benefits. The following are some core issues that B-side customers may be concerned about when purchasing micro-air pumps:
1. Performance parameters and applicability
Flow and pressure: The B-side customer will pay attention to the flow and pressure parameters of the micro-air pump to ensure that it can meet the specific application requirements. For example, some industries may require high flow or high pressure air pumps to support production processes.
Vacuum degree: Vacuum degree is an important performance indicator for applications where vacuum is required. The B client is concerned that the vacuum of the micro air pump is high enough to overcome the resistance and achieve the desired vacuum level.
Stability and reliability: B-side customers usually want the selected micro air pump to have a high degree of stability and reliability to reduce downtime and maintenance costs.
2. Working environment and compatibility
Temperature and humidity: The client will consider the temperature and humidity adaptability of the micro-air pump in a specific working environment to ensure its long-term stable operation.
Corrosive: In some industries, such as chemicals or pharmaceuticals, corrosive substances may be present in the working environment. B-side customers will pay attention to the corrosion resistance of the micro air pump to ensure that it will not be damaged by corrosion.
Material and compatibility: The B client will choose the appropriate material (such as stainless steel, aluminum alloy, etc.) according to the actual application scenario, and consider the compatibility of the micro air pump with other equipment.
Third, energy consumption and efficiency
Energy consumption: With the rise of energy costs, B-side customers are increasingly concerned about the energy consumption level of micro-air pumps. They tend to choose products with low energy consumption and high efficiency to reduce production costs.
Efficiency: High-efficiency micro air pumps are able to convert electrical energy into mechanical energy more efficiently, thus reducing energy loss and heating. This is essential to improve production efficiency and reduce energy consumption.
4. Maintenance and repair
Wearing parts and life: The B-side customer will pay attention to the wearing parts of the micro-air pump and its service life in order to develop a reasonable maintenance plan and reduce maintenance costs.
Ease of service: Micro-air pumps that are easy to maintain and repair can reduce downtime and service difficulty, thereby increasing productivity. B-side customers will consider the structural characteristics of the product, the maintenance cycle, and the availability of repair parts and other factors.
5. After-sales service and support
After-sales service policy: B-side customers will pay attention to the supplier's after-sales service policy, including warranty period, maintenance response speed, technical support, etc., to ensure that they can get timely and effective support during use.
Technical support and training: For complex application scenarios or products requiring special customization, B-side customers may ask the supplier to provide technical support and training services to ensure that employees can properly operate and maintain the micro air pump.
To sum up, B-side customers will consider multiple aspects when purchasing micro-air pumps to ensure that the selected products can meet their production or operational needs and bring economic benefits.
